This is a part-time, on-site role located in Tualatin, OR, for an Athletic Trainer. The trainer will be responsible for conducting injury prevention services, including ergonomic assessments, early intervention strategies, and employee education. Day-to-day responsibilities involve evaluating and addressing early signs and symptoms of musculoskeletal disorders, coaching employees on proper ergonomics, and providing injury prevention training tailored to the needs of the workforce. Additionally, the Athletic Trainer will collaborate with management and employees to foster a culture of safety in the workplace.
